Data—The distinguishing factor
The factor that differentiates information technology from technology is the primary focus on electronic data. In other words, IT is concerned with creating, storing, processing, securing, and sharing data and information. Furthermore, the internet, hardware, software, and networking are part of information technology. Altogether, IT builds communication networks, helps in troubleshooting issues, and ensures efficiency and protection of systems.
